And this (Qur'an) is a revelation from the Lord of all the worlds, 192 The Faithful Spirit has descended with it, 193 upon thy heart, that thou mayest be one of the warners, 194 In plain Arabic speech. 195 And indeed it is mentioned in the earlier Books. 196 Was it not a sign for them, that it is known to the learned of the Children of Israel? 197 If We had sent it down on a barbarian 198 And he had recited it to them, and they had not believed (it would have been different). 199 Thus it passes through the hearts of the criminals. 200 They will not believe in it to the extent that they see the painful punishment. 201 And it shall come to them all of a sudden, while they shall not perceive; 202 They will therefore say, “Will we get some respite?” 203 Do they wish to hasten Our punishment? 204 But hast thou ever considered [this]: If We do allow them to enjoy [this life] for some years, 205 and then Our torment will strike them, 206 none of their luxuries will be able to save them from the torment? 207 Never have We destroyed a town without sending down messengers to warn it, 208 We have never been unjust to anyone. 209 And the satans have not brought it down. 210 They are unworthy of it, nor can they do it. 211 Indeed they, from [its] hearing, are removed. 212 Therefore do not worship another deity along with Allah, for you will be punished. 213 Warn your close relatives 214 Lower thy wing to those who follow thee, being believers; 215 And if they (thy kinsfolk) disobey thee, say: Lo! I am innocent of what they do. 216 Put your trust in the Mighty One, the Merciful, 217 who sees thee when thou standest [alone,] 218 and [sees] thy behaviour among those who prostrate themselves [before Him]: 219 He is All-Hearing, All-Knowing. 220 Shall I inform you (of him) upon whom the Shaitans descend? 221 They descend on every great accuser, extreme sinner. (The magicians) 222 The satans try to listen to the heavens but many of them are liars. 223 As for poets, only the wayward follow them. 224 Do you not see that they wander about in every valley 225 And they say what they do not do, 226 except those who believed and acted righteously and remembered Allah much, and when they themselves were subjected to wrong, they exacted retribution no more than to the extent of the wrong? Soon will the wrong-doers know the end that they shall reach. 227
Allah Almighty has spoken the truth.
End of Surah: The Poets (Alshu'araa'). Sent down in Mecca after The Inevitable (Al-Waaqe'ah) before The Ant (Al-Naml)

When reading the Colorful Quran in English transliterated Arabic mode, you may not notice that there is an algorithm designed to match the pause requirements of the original Arabic scripture, (waqf signs). As you may know, the original Arabic Quran has five main types of pauses, (waqf) signs. (1) Compulsory break, where the transliteration uses a full stop. (2) Optional pause with the preference for pausing, where the transliteration uses a comma that may appear with a probability of two thirds. (3) Optional stop with an equal preference for pausing and resuming, where the transliteration uses a comma that may appear with a half-half probability. (4) Optional pause with the preference for resuming, where the transliteration uses a comma that may appear with a chance of one third. (5) Attraction pause, also called hugging, or (mu’anaka) sign, where it is compulsory to pause at either one of two nearby positions, but not both; where the transliteration inserts a comma at either one of the two locations with a half-half probability.
